Q: Is 11,464,797 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 11,464,797 is a composite number.

Why is 11,464,797 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 11,464,797 can be evenly divided by 1 3 293 879 13,043 39,129 3,821,599 and 11,464,797, with no remainder.

Since 11,464,797 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,464,797, it is a composite number.
